South Korea Faces Political Turmoil

Image courtesy of : AFP (JUNG YEON-JE)

South Korea is grappling with a significant political crisis, threatening its established democratic reputation. President Yoon Suk-yeol's recent declaration of martial law has caused friction with key global players like Japan, the USA, and the EU, who are now distancing themselves.

In a dramatic turn, both President Yoon and interim President Han Duck-soo have been impeached by the National Assembly. This unprecedented move has sparked economic concerns, with the South Korean won hitting its lowest value since 2009. The opposition Democratic Party, led by Lee Jae-myung, is pushing for stability but continues to challenge the ruling party's actions.

Meanwhile, Deputy Prime Minister Choi Sang-mok temporarily assumes leadership, navigating a landscape fraught with tension. The Constitutional Court's upcoming decision on the impeachments will be crucial in determining the country's political future.

Amidst these upheavals, South Korea's leadership is under pressure to restore domestic and international confidence.

South Korea: Political Crisis Deepens

Politics
South Korea's political crisis is deepening: While the Constitutional Court is reviewing the impeachment of suspended President Yoon Suk Yeol, the National Assembly has now also relieved Acting President Han Duck Soo of his duties. It is the first time in the country's history that the interim president has also been removed from office. 192 of the 300 lawmakers voted in favor of the motion brought by the opposition.
